520 |a This extensive text includes both the transcribed proceedings of the meeting of the Tenth International Congress of Women in Paris as well as formal essays included by conference participants. The conference itself met over a period of several days, with themes and topics dispersed throughout various days' sessions, but the formal presentations appear thematically in the tome. The first topic explored is women's roles in public and private charities, with two essays focusing respectively on women's participation in private charities internationally in the ten years preceding the meeting and recent improvements made to workers' housing. The theme of hygiene comprises the conference's second major theme, with two formal presentations on women's roles combating alcoholism and tuberculosis. Third is the topic of education and essay topics here explore character education, how different countries have used education to respond to contemporary anxieties, and how to protect youth from moral corruption found in magazines, plays, images, and public events. The fourth major theme is law and legislation, and authors in this domain questioned the legal rights of women vis-à-vis their husbands as well as the civic capacity of married women in various national contexts. Questions concerning women's right to work comprised the fifth major theme; protective labor laws for women's work and a discussion of a minimum wage for women supplemented this topic. The sixth topic addressed by the Congress was women's suffrage, including discussions on married women's nationality and women's moral influence as voters. The conference's major themes conclude with examinations of female university students, possibilities open for women desiring careers, and the role of women in pacifism and in international conflict resolution. The text ends with a transcript of the conference's closing sessions, as well as adopted resolutions and a helpful index outlining the contributions of all participants.
